Stuffed Manicotti Recipe

Ingredients:

1-2 lb. lean hamburger
1 med. onion, finely chopped
4 stalks celery, finely chopped
1 pkg. fresh mushrooms, finely chopped
1 orange pepper, finely chopped
1 red pepper, finely chopped
1 yellow pepper, finely chopped
1 tsp basil
1 tsp thyme
1 tsp oregano
1 tsp parsley
2 bottles spaghetti sauce
1 1/2 c. old Cheddar cheese, shredded
1/2 c. Feta cheese
1 c. Mozzarella, shredded
1 pkg. Express Manicotti noodles

Directions:

Preheat oven to 350° F. Pour 1 bottle of sauce in bottom of 9x13" dish.
Fry hamburger in lg. skillet. Drain. (Return drippings to skillet) Place hamburger in lg. bowl. To skillet add vegetables, thyme, basil, parsley & mushrooms. Cook until tender. Drain. Add to hamburger & combine with 1 cup of the Cheddar & Feta. Stuff Manicotti with mixture using a piping bag or long end of soup spoon. Place stuffed noodles on top of sauce. Add remaining sauce & top with remaining cheese. Sprinkle with oregano. Bake 40-50 min till noodles are tender.

Personal Notes:

Measurements are only a guideline. Add as much or as little as you wish. Depends on the size of dish you use. End result is well worth the effort!
